BATTERY CHARGING
The e-bike motor is powered by a Li-Ion battery. Unlike other types of batteries, Lithium-Ion batteries
are not subject to the so-called memory effect and can be charged even if they are not completely
discharged.
The maximum battery capacity is usually reached after several charging cycles.
The first time you charge the battery, charging time should be approximately 12 hours.
•
Connect the charger to the battery. The charging cable slot is located on the right side of the
battery and is protected by a rubber cap on some models.
•
Immediately after connecting the charger, the battery starts charging. During charging, the
LED indicator on the charger will light up red, the battery is charging. When the battery is
charged, the LED indicator lights up green.
If the LED does not turn red, it may be due to the battery overheating. In this case, allow the
battery to cool before connecting the charger.
The battery is equipped with a charge progress indicator. After pressing the red (POWER) button, you
can check the current charging progress.
5 LED = battery is charged to 100% of its capacity
3 LED = charging is 70-40% complete.
1 LED = charging is 0-40% complete.
If no LED lights up, it means that the battery is completely discharged and needs to be
charged before use.
